ATLANTA — We’ve been here before.
Georgia football and Alabama have faced off in the SEC Championship the past few seasons. Safe to say it hasn’t gone well.
The Bulldogs have lost every recent SEC Championship game to the Crimson Tide. In fact, they’ve obtained a 1-7 record in the past 10 years between National Championship games and regular season matchups.
But the key is the one win. When the Bulldogs last played the Crimson Tide twice, they came away with a win in the 2021 National Championship.
Could UGA repeat history? Could Alabama continue its dominance against the Bulldogs?
Turns out it was the former. Georgia won dominantly, taking down Alabama 28-7, nearly shutting out the team it's struggled with in the past.
